Releases: kubernetes-retired/kui
10.4.1
This release includes several minor fixes. See the 10.4.0 release notes for more details of what is new in the 10.4 series.
Fixes
lscommand can be slow against larger directories#7668- User has no way to know whether Kui has successfully connected to S3. Try
uporup --ibmif you are a user of IBM Cloud#7670
For Kui Developers
10.4.0
With this release, Kui should no longer emit the annoying "renderer process reuse" message every time you launch it.
Features
- Apple Silicon builds
- New s3 plugin. You can use this to browse CommonCrawl data, or your own S3 buckets; try
ls /s3/aws/commoncrawl. If you have already set up your terminal for access to AWS or IBM cloud or a local Minio instance, then tryls /s3to see your own buckets. We will be backfilling the documentation in the next release#7537 - Initial support for multi-line input. You may now use HERE docs and backslash
\line continuations in Kui#7614 - When running Kui as a kubectl plugin ("popup mode"), Kui now runs with split terminals
Design
Chores
- Version bump to Electron v11, and fixes for "renderer process reuse" and other spurious console messages
#7606
Fixes
- Kui now more reliably scrolls output into view after command execution
#7525 export FOO=$(echo hi)now works#7609- PTY apps, such as
viare now properly sized to the Kui viewport#7599#7601 - Kui blocks have strange orange focus outline
#7597 - Cleanups to "Lightweight" themes
#7621 - Text in StatusStripe widgets oddly overflows in narrower windows
#7583 - Sidecar toolbar buttons now use patternfly tooltips
#7573
For Kui Developers
- Notebook clients can now dictate that displayed notebooks are readonly, executable, or output-only, in any combination needed.
- Bottom input clients now work with split terminals
10.3.12
10.3.6
This release includes a large number of bug fixes. The following covers some highlights.
Features
macOS builds are now signed and notarized. This should help to avoid tedious whitelisting on every Kui updateUgh. Take-back on that. Electron has upstream bugs that cause very laggy performance with signed builds on macOS v11 (Big Sur): electron/electron#26143- Kubernetes Logs tab now has a typeahead filter for log lines (see gif to the right)
#7493
Fixes
- Windows builds should be more stable now
- Cmd+W now closes a Kui tab. Previously this keyboard shortcut would only close the current split
#7487 - More OpenShift system namespaces are now presented as such
#7417 kubectl get ... > file.outnow works#7406kubectl getqueries againstname.<group>now work as expected#7399kubectl get ingressand any other queries against singular Kinds that end in "s" now work#7387
v10.2.1
v10.2.0
See the 10.0.1 Release Notes for a complete sumary of what is new in Kui 10. This release includes bug fixes and updates to the UI for switching between Kubernetes contexts and namespaces.
Features
- The UI for context and namespace selection has been enhanced. You may now use type-ahead find to make your new choice. The namespace selector groups namespaces so as to distinguish user namespaces from system namespaces.
Fixes
- 065990d Use placeholder text to instruct users on how to use Ctrl+D to close splits
- c07e5a0 users of
ocwith outdated or non-existentkubectlmay see failures - 4762dd8
kubectl get -o custom-columnsnow benefits from the same speed optimizations of non-custom gets - 7d7d273
--kubeconfigor--contextoptions may not work - e3d4a9c f424b5e
k create ns 1, i.e. operations against numeric namespace names, would fail - d4ea65b some corner case kubectl watch requests do not watch
- 142187c ls | grep does not properly escape dots and stars in the grep
- 819dc3c Tab Completion view color codes partial completions if no slashes
- ce6b10e
ls ~may fail
For Developers
v10.1.4
See the 10.0.1 Release Notes for a complete sumary of what is new in Kui 10. This release includes bug fixes.
Fixes
- a60dccd ctrl+c then clear results in wrong command being executed
- 9a6a1e5
ls | grepandls | wcdo not always work as expected
For Kui Developers
- 8b54aca numeric responses for command handlers may not be displayed
v10.1.3
See the 10.0.1 Release Notes for a complete sumary of what is new in Kui 10. This release includes bug fixes.
Fixes
- d1dac89 Table columns were not sortable
For Kui Developers
v10.1.2
See the 10.0.1 Release Notes for a complete sumary of what is new in Kui 10. This release includes bug fixes.
Fixes
- bc2dd7a
oc logindoes not invalidate the kubectl proxy - 50ca156 Tooltips may present odd internal
kuiexectext - f750982 blocks with Processing commands cannot be removed
- 5dd9ed0 empty tables do not use PatternFly's "empty state" UI
For Kui Developers
- 36b91c8 console errors are shown for clients that do not define a list of notebooks
v10.1.1
See the 10.0.1 Release Notes for a complete sumary of what is new in Kui 10. This release includes bug fixes and a new notebook.
Fixes
- e55895a when there're 3 splits, clicking table cells in the first split fail
- ba73576 table clicks fail when the maximum number of splits is reached
- bebeb95 Markdown misparses certain links
- 011cf02 Markdown links should have a tooltip
- d8e1be0 Markdown lists may lack bullets/numbers
Documentation
API Fixes (for Kui developers)
- 4a6974f fetchFileString aggressively calls toString on all objects




